Fusion DAC
When it comes to audio digital-to-analogue converters
(DACs), there are two primary designs: discrete ladder DAC and Delta-Sigma DAC.
The popular discrete ladder DAC design allows designers to use different
components for various parts of the circuit, providing greater flexibility in
tailoring the sound signature. However, the discrete ladder DACs can suffer
from non-linearities caused by precision mismatches in the resistor values.
Uneven temperature changes also play a significant role in introducing non-linearity
to the system. This can lead to distortion and reduced overall performance.
Delta-Sigma DACs are known for their high accuracy and
resolution, which is achieved through precise manufacturing processes. These
DACs also offer a high dynamic range and low noise and distortion level, making
them well-suited for high quality music playback applications. However,
Delta-Sigma DACs are often integrated with complicated digital circuits like
Phase Lock Loop (PLL), digital filter, and oversampling circuits, which can
make them less customizable for designers. This can limit their suitability for
high-end applications where customization and flexibility are important.
AURALiC's Fusion DAC design in the VEGA G2.2 is a pioneering
technology that combines the best features of discrete ladder and Delta-Sigma
DAC designs. This innovative approach uses a high performance, manufacturer DAC
chip as a basis for modification. Most of the DAC chips’ functions, such as
PLL, digital filter, and oversampling circuits are bypassed, and instead
AURALiC's proprietary clock reconstruction, digital filter, and oversampling
technologies are deployed. This unique approach ensures that only the precise
switching network inside a DAC chip is used for the final digital-to-analogue
conversion stage, resulting in exceptional sound quality. This Fusion DAC
design facilitates a unique level of customization and flexibility, providing
users with the ability to fine-tune and optimize the DAC to their individual
preferences. Overall, AURALiC’s proprietary implementation of this unique,
in-house developed technology represents a significant advancement in DAC
design, offering exceptional performance and unparalleled sound quality.
Direct Data Recording
The VEGA G2.2 is equipped with AURALiC's proprietary Direct
Data Recording (DDR) technology. Unlike traditional DACs that rely on a Phase
Lock Loop (PLL) circuit to reconstruct the incoming clock signal, our DDR
technology avoids using a PLL circuit as it cannot fully remove the distortion
and jitter present in the original clock signal. Instead, we record the audio
data directly into the Tesla G3 processing platform's system memory in binary
format, bypassing the original clock signal entirely.
Next, a series of advanced digital filters and oversampling
algorithms process the audio data, optimizing it for the best possible
performance. To power the DAC operation and time the Tesla G3's data output to
the DAC chip, a dual 60fs Femto Clocks - one for 44.1x and another for 48x
sampling frequencies - acts as a master clock, independent of the input audio
signal.
As a result of these cutting-edge technologies, the VEGA
G2.2 is immune to the input signal's distortion and jitter, delivering the
highest level of sound quality possible. The result is an unparalleled
listening experience, with stunning detail, clarity, and precision that is free
from any distortion or jitter.
Passive Analogue Volume Control
Analogue volume control is widely regarded as the superior
approach for achieving high-performance audio playback. Whilst digital volume
control can accurately reduce the signal level, it cannot reduce the noise
floor level of the output signal. As a result, when using digital volume
control to attenuate the signal by a large amount, the system's dynamic range
is inevitably heavily compromised. Analogue volume control, however, can reduce
both the signal level and noise floor, whilst retaining the system's dynamic
range.
The VEGA G2.2 features a true analogue ladder resistor
volume control that delivers exceptional and noise-free control without
introducing any distortion. This volume control system includes eight
coil-latch relays that remain inactive when not in operation, consuming no
power and emitting no EMI noise. Once the system is adjusted, it remains electronically
invisible, thereby further enhancing the already outstanding audio performance
of the VEGA G2.
Analogue Preamplifier
The VEGA G2.2 maintains the successful analogue preamplifier
function from the original VEGA G2.1. This feature has been enhanced in the new
design, with the output level increased from 4.4Vrms to 6Vrms to meet the
demands of even the most power-hungry amplifiers. Additionally, the ORFEO
Class-A output modules ensure that the balanced output can drive loads well
below 600ohm with minimal degradation in performance.
If desired, users can disable the preamplifier function
through software, with the option to reduce the output level to 2Vrms, allowing
for the use of external preamplifiers. In addition, a convenient home theatre
bypass mode is available for analogue input channels.
Galvanic Isolation
Modern high-end DACs are capable of providing exceptional
dynamic range that can reveal minute details in the original recording.
However, achieving such a dynamic range requires extremely clean clocks, power
supplies, and signal feeding into the DAC. To ensure that no noise can be
coupled into the DAC circuit, the VEGA G2.2 is equipped with high-speed
galvanic isolators that are strategically positioned between the Tesla G3
processing platform and the ultra-sensitive audio circuit. These isolators
provide physical separation and protection against interference for the DAC
whilst enabling data transfer.
